Sainsbury's

Sainsbury's is one of the most renowned supermarket chains in the UK. Sainsbury's is a favorite among millions of customers because of its commitment to providing quality, affordable groceries and making a positive impact in communities. The company provides a broad range of products like clothing and electrical goods. Sainsbury's also places a top importance on customer service through its knowledgeable staff and efficient check-out procedures.

John James Sainsbury founded the company in 1869 in Drury Lane in London with his wife Mary Ann. In the early twentieth century, Sainsbury's began to pioneer self-service supermarkets in the UK by constructing stores that carried a wide variety of food and non-food products. The company later expanded into additional areas, like banking services and out-of-town stores.

In the 1990s, Sainsbury's began to open smaller "Country Town" stores which were conceived to serve large villages as well as rural areas. These small supermarkets were intended to compete with local stores and 0553721256.ussoft.kr chains owned rivals. This strategy worked, and Sainsbury's was able to maintain its market share in these markets.

Debenhams

Debenhams is among the oldest department stores. The history of the store dates to 1778, when William Clark opened his draper's shop in Wigmore Street. Clark partnered with Suffolk businessman William Debenham in 1813, and the store was renamed as Clark & Debenham.

The company was once one of the top British retailer However, in recent years it has slipped behind its rivals. It went into administration for first-time in March 2020. A group of investors bought the company, and it has reopened for trading. The chain has 178 stores in the UK and Ireland.

In the early 1980s, Debenhams was taken over by the Burton Group. In 1998, it regained its independence when it separated from the parent company. It was listed on the London Stock Exchange. In this time, it underwent major restructuring and introduced exclusive brands and products like Designers at Debenhams. It also purchased the Danish group of department stores Magasin Du Nord.

The Co-op

The Co-op has rolled out its own online store as it seeks to increase membership. Members can shop on the site to buy groceries and other items as well as receive exclusive Member prices and personalized weekly deals. The Co-op provides free home delivery to certain areas in London and Manchester. The company uses zero emission electric cargo bikes to ship orders online.

The chain offers food items from their own stores online and has joined forces with Deliveroo. It is also conducting a small scale test of robot delivery in Northern Ireland. The Co-op has also revamped its reward programme, adding new perks for customers. This includes discounts on Co-op branded goods and a new community reward system. The Co-op claims the changes will save customers an average of PS500 a year.
